Luteinizing

Hormone is a hormone that promotes secretion of sex hormones.

In females: It triggers ovulation.

In males: It triggers leydig

cells that produce testosterone.

What is the function of Leydig cells in reproduction?

The function of Leydig cells, which are located in the testicle, is to produce testosterone. They can only function when luteinizing hormone is present.


Is the main source of tropic hormones from the pituitary gland?

Yes, the main source of tropic hormones is the anterior pituitary gland. This gland releases hormones that control the function of other endocrine glands in the body, such as the thyroid gland, adrenal gland, and gonads. The tropic hormones include thyroid-stimulating hormone (TSH), adrenocorticotropic hormone (ACTH), foll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H), and luteinizing hormone (LH).
